How Do Air Fryer Liners Work?
The Role of an Air Fryer Liner
An air fryer liner acts like a protective shield between your food and the basket. It catches grease, crumbs, and small pieces that fall off during cooking. This means your basket stays cleaner, and you spend less time scrubbing after each use.

Maintaining Airflow for Even Cooking
Air fryers cook food by circulating hot air around it. For the best results, this airflow must not be blocked. That’s why most liners have holes or perforations. These holes let air move freely while still catching messes.
Reducing Food Sticking and Burning
Some foods, like cheese or marinated items, can stick to the basket or tray. Liners create a non-stick surface that helps prevent this. This reduces burnt-on bits, which are tricky to clean and can cause smoke during cooking.

Types of Air Fryer Liners
Parchment Paper Liners
The most popular choice, parchment paper liners are heat-resistant and often pre-cut with holes. They’re disposable and easy to use. Just make sure to buy ones specifically made for air fryers to avoid poor airflow.
Silicone Mats
Reusable silicone liners are another excellent option. They’re non-stick, heat-resistant, and eco-friendly since you can wash and reuse them many times. Silicone mats often have holes as well to maintain airflow.
Perforated Aluminum Foil Liners
Some people use aluminum foil with holes poked in it. While this can work, foil is less flexible and can block airflow if not used carefully. Also, avoid using foil with acidic foods, as it may react with them.
What to Avoid
Never use plastic liners or wax paper, as these materials can melt or release harmful chemicals when heated. Stick to liners labeled as food-safe and heat-resistant up to the air fryer’s max temperature (usually around 400°F).
How to Use Air Fryer Liners Properly
Choose the Right Size
Measure your air fryer basket and select liners that fit snugly without overlapping the edges. Oversized liners can block airflow and cause uneven cooking.
Place Liners Correctly
Always place the liner at the bottom of the basket or tray, making sure holes align with the air vents. Avoid lining the sides or top, as this can disrupt air circulation.
Do Not Preheat with Liners Inside
To prevent liners from flying up due to strong air currents, don’t preheat your air fryer with the liner alone. Add food on top of the liner before starting the cooking cycle.
Clean or Replace Liners After Use
Disposable liners should be discarded after each use. Reusable silicone mats need washing with warm soapy water. Regular maintenance keeps them effective and hygienic.
Are Air Fryer Liners Safe?
Materials and Heat Resistance
Safety depends largely on the liner’s material. Parchment paper and silicone liners designed for high temperatures are safe to use. Avoid anything that isn’t heat-resistant or food-grade.
Preventing Fire Hazards
Proper use is key to safety. Blocking air vents or using liners without holes can cause overheating. Also, never leave the air fryer unattended while cooking.
Watch for Signs of Damage
If you notice your liner charring, melting, or releasing strange odors, stop using it immediately. Replace with a new liner that meets safety standards.

Frequently Asked Questions
Do air fryer liners affect cooking time or temperature?
When used properly with holes for airflow, air fryer liners do not significantly affect cooking time or temperature. However, liners that block vents may cause uneven cooking or require slight adjustments.
Can I use regular parchment paper as an air fryer liner?
It’s best to use parchment paper liners specifically designed for air fryers, as they have perforations to allow airflow. Regular parchment paper without holes can block air circulation and affect cooking results.
Are silicone air fryer liners reusable?
Yes, silicone liners are reusable and easy to clean. They are heat-resistant and eco-friendly, making them a popular choice for many air fryer users.
Will air fryer liners prevent food from sticking?
Yes, liners provide a non-stick surface that helps prevent food from sticking to the basket, reducing burnt-on residue and making cleanup easier.
Is it safe to use aluminum foil as an air fryer liner?
You can use perforated aluminum foil liners cautiously, but avoid covering the entire basket as it may block airflow. Also, avoid using foil with acidic foods, which can cause reactions.
How often should I replace disposable air fryer liners?
Disposable liners should be replaced after each use to ensure cleanliness and safety. Reusable silicone mats can last for many uses with proper care.
